




Kerros Rect — Banded Onyx Plinth & Travertine Rectangular Dining Table
The Kerros Rect is a table built entirely on the principle of geological time made visible. The plateau is a wide rectangle of honed travertine — cream-ivory, warm, its open pores and subtle texture reading as something between stone and sand. The base is a solid rectangular plinth of banded onyx: the same mineral family, a different geological process, and an entirely different visual outcome. Where the travertine is uniform and soft, the onyx is stratified — horizontal bands of cream, honey, amber and pale gold stacked in tight parallel layers, the sedimentary record of a mineral spring that deposited its calcite over thousands of years, layer by layer, each one a different moment in geological time.
The plinth is a pure rectangular block — no taper, no relief, no curve. Its proportions are those of an architectural element rather than a furniture element: wide, low, and resolved. It extends to within a few centimetres of the plateau's edge on the short sides, creating a strong visual continuity between base and surface. From a distance the table reads as a single horizontal plane — as if the plateau were simply resting on a band of earth. Only when you approach does the stratification of the onyx reveal itself in full: the individual layers, the slight variations in translucency, the way the amber bands glow differently under different light conditions.
The bichrome approach — travertine plateau, onyx plinth — is the Kerros's essential proposition. Both stones share the same warm, cream-amber palette, but they express that palette in completely different vocabularies: one matte, uniform and tactile; the other banded, dramatic and geological. Together they create a table that is simultaneously calm and visually inexhaustible. Suited for 6 to 10 guests depending on size.

Materials & Construction
Plateau: Honed travertine — cream-ivory, matte finish, open-pore texture
Plinth base: Banded onyx (honey/cream/amber striated) — same warm palette, stratified surface
Plinth finish: Honed — matte, enhances the depth of the banding without gloss
Plateau edge: Square-cut, honed — precise, architectural, no ornamentation
Plinth form: Pure rectangular block — no taper, no curve, no relief
Onyx banding orientation: Horizontal — strata run parallel to floor, maximising visual impact
Connection: Concealed threaded rod — zero visible hardware
- Dimensions : 183 × 97 × 76 cm
The Kerros Rect draws from the Italian postmodern tradition of the 1970–80s — the moment when architects and designers began treating stone not as a building material but as a primary design vocabulary, and when the plinth form became a statement of architectural conviction rather than a structural necessity.
